How does congress deals with foreign policies?

History
1 answer:
bulgar [2K]3 years ago
8 0
<span>Congress and foreign policy. The constitutional function of Congress is essentially to act as a check on presidential power. Only Congress can declare war, and the Senate must approve all treaties and confirm the president's nominees for ambassadorial and cabinet positions.</span>
